Let's Walk is a really great song that I don't think comes across very well on the album. I like Mark Harelik alright, but he and Vicki don't blend very well which undercuts the effectiveness of the number.

And I'd be hard-pressed to name a better written song than Dividing Day. It's a perfect marriage of melody, rhythm, lyrics, and character.
